Network addressing uses the
Uniform Naming Convention
(UNC) format. This format looks like the following:
\\device name\share
name
. In this example,
HPMediaVault
is the device name, and
FileShare
is
the Shared Folder or
share
name.
(
For those more familiar with
networking terms, the word
Share
is often
used instead of
Shared Folder.
)

Use Windows Explorer to browse:
When you installed the media vault, you had the choice of mapping drive letters to FileShare, MediaShare and
Backup. If you mapped drive letters to those Shared Folders, you can
browse
to those folders using Windows
Explorer. (See
Map drive
letters to your Shared Folders
. )
1. Click
Start, All Programs, Accessories, Windows Explorer, My Computer
.
2.
Double
-
click
the name of the Shared Folder you want to open. The drive letter will be located at the
end of
the name. (If you haven
t saved any files to your Shared Folders, the next screen that appears
will be
empty.)
In this example, MediaShare is mapped to drive letter
M.
FileShare is
mapped to drive letter
Q."
Use Windows Vista Explorer to browse:
When you installed the media vault, you had the choice of mapping drive letters to FileShare, MediaShare and
Backup. If you mapped drive letters to those Shared Folders, you can
browse
to those folders using Windows
Explorer. (See
Map drive
letters to your Shared Folders
. )
1. Click
Start,
Computer
.
2.
Double
-
click
the name of the Shared Folder you want to open. The drive letter will be located at the
end of
the name. (If you haven
t saved any files to your Shared Folders, the next screen that appears
will be
empty.)
In this example, MediaShare is mapped to drive letter
T.
FileShare is
mapped to drive letter
V."
